454 - 4Sum II.
Medium
Given four integer arrays
nums1
,nums2
,nums3
, andnums4
all of lengthn
, return the number of tuples(i, j, k, l)
such that:0 <= i, j, k, l < n
nums1[i] + nums2[j] + nums3[k] + nums4[l] == 0
Example 1:
Input: nums1 = 1,2, nums2 = -2,-1, nums3 = -1,2, nums4 = 0,2
Output: 2
Explanation: The two tuples are:
(0, 0, 0, 1) -> nums10 + nums20 + nums30 + nums41 = 1 + (-2) + (-1) + 2 = 0
(1, 1, 0, 0) -> nums11 + nums21 + nums30 + nums40 = 2 + (-1) + (-1) + 0 = 0
Example 2:
Input: nums1 = 0, nums2 = 0, nums3 = 0, nums4 = 0
Output: 1
Constraints:
n == nums1.length
n == nums2.length
n == nums3.length
n == nums4.length
1 <= n <= 200
<code>-2<sup>28</sup><= nums1i, nums2i, nums3i, nums4i<= 2<sup>28</sup></code>
